Abstract
The spread of misinformation on social media poses a major challenge to information
integrity and public discourse. This study examines the effectiveness of detecting
misinformation in the Tshivenda language, an underrepresented linguistic context, on social
media platforms. Tshivenda is a Bantu language spoken primarily in the Limpopo province
of South Africa [1]. This research analysed misinformation patterns, adapted existing
detection techniques, and examined the influence of Tshivenda language linguistics.
Through an extensive literature review, the investigation examined the state of the art in
misinformation detection and its applicability to languages with limited datasets. To address
this gap, we used LSTM models, a type of RNN known for capturing long-range
dependencies, for misinformation detection. This research involved training and evaluating
the LSTM model on the Tshivenda and English datasets. This comparative analysis
provided valuable insights into the challenges and opportunities that linguistic diversity
presents in detecting misinformation. The results shed light on the effectiveness of using
